Vine name: Ucelùt

Grapes: white berry

Name: I.G.P. Venezia Giulia

Production area: Western Friuli foothills area – Province of Pordenone – F.V.G. Region – Italy

Soil: medium-textured

Training system: double and simple Guyot; planting density 4000 vines per hectare, number of buds: 12 to 14 per vine

Yield: 60 to 70 quintals per hectare

Vineyard location: Valeriano, Pinzano al Tagliamento e Castelnovo del Friuli.

 

ORGANOLEPTIC SHEET

Wine: Ucelùt

Colour: golden yellow

Bouquet: floral (acacia flowers, wisteria, honeycomb), intense

Taste: sweet, warm, soft, balanced

Food matches: meditation or dessert wine ideal with biscuits or cakes made with puff pastry and almond; also with blue or mature cheese, fig jam

Serving temperature: 8–10 degrees

Alcohol: 12.5% vol*

(* Depending on the year, the analytical values may vary slightly)
